Output 584cc45de30fe2eb4941d161d081e53fc5fc67ed5e33ff07fda3db41596da50b:0

value
2500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6d014f319a6e42349c80148c7f9248f0949390d845cbb2c335cfc0a9ca26aa6
address
bc1pumgpfuce5mjzxjwgq9yv07fy3uy5jwgds3wtktpntn7q489zd2nqvk705r
transaction
584cc45de30fe2eb4941d161d081e53fc5fc67ed5e33ff07fda3db41596da50b
confirmations
154366
spent
true